Background technology
The migration of researching fish and a kind of method of the stock of fish, put after the fish captured in natural water area are marked
Raw water domain is gone back to, can the situation such as migration, distribution, growth and resource of researching fish according to this during recapture.1886,
Petersen etc. is using the size and the death rate of the method estimation closing water body Mesichthyes population for making to indicate to fish, tagging
Thus (tagged releasing) technology grows up.
Clown fish is not unique hermaphroditic animal, but they are that male few in number becomes female, female
The species of male can not be become.Each clown fish population has the female and several bull of a dominant position, Hou Zhe
Adolescence is hermaphroditic.If the female death with dominant position, wherein a bull will undergo hormone change,
The new female being transformed into the population.In the egg-laying season, male fish and female fish have shield nest, protect the territorial behavior of ovum.One end of its ovum
Have filament to be fixed on stone, or so week hatching, after juvenile fish floats a period of time in water layer, can just inhabit to sea
On the symbiosis biology such as certain herbaceous plants with big flowers.Because having one or two white stripes on the face, like the clown in Beijing opera, so being commonly called as " small
Ugly fish ".

The present invention wear-resistant coating preparation method be:Solid material in formula components is crushed, by weight, takes 30
Part water, it is put into homogenizer, adds the solid material of crushing and the dispersant of the weight of solid material 2 ~ 4% stirs at 65 DEG C
10min is mixed, the liquid material added in formula, 4min is stirred under the conditions of 92 DEG C, obtains wear-resistant paint, be coated onto and shaping
Wear-resistant coating is formed after drying and processing after wheel group 15 and second group of surface spraying wear-resistant coating of wheel group 14.
The dispersant added in wear-resistant coating preparation process is made up of following component and parts by weight:Unrighted acid 10-
20 parts, unsaturated fatty acid ester 1-5 parts, unsaturated amides 2-4 parts, triethanolamine TEOA0.3-0.7 parts, alkylphenol-polyethenoxy
Ether 7-17 parts, liquid caustic soda 22-38 parts, solid-liquid material in coating is remarkably improved by the dispersant added in dope preparing process
Dispersiveness and prepare coating gloss, shorten the preparation time of coating, the triethanolamine TEOA added in dispersant is not
The dispersion effect of solid-liquid material in dope preparing process can only be promoted, can also lift the coating elasticity of preparation.
